IELTS Writing Task 1 question
The graph below gives information on the numbers of participants for different activities at one social centre in Melbourne, Australia for the period 2000 to 2020.
Summarise the information by selecting and reporting the main features, and make comparisons where relevant.
Student answer (Band 6.0)
The line graph illustrates the number of people who participated in 5 different activities at a social centre in Melbourne, Australian between the year 2000 to 2020.
Overall, the film club had the highest number of participants in film club among the 5 activities over these 20 years. Other than that, there was no participant for musical performances until 2005 which grew afterwards on the later years.
The number of participants remained 60 or above throughout the 20 years time period in case of film club, whereas, martial arts had gone through ups and downs between 30 to 40 people. In 2000, the third popular activity was amateur dramatics with about 25 participants which grew a bit in the year 2005 but, then had a steady fall for the next 15 years.
On the contrary, the number of participants of table tennis grew slightly in 2005 and was stable until 2010. Afterwards, it had a sharp rise for the next 10 years, increasing the number into almost 50 people. Lastly, even though there was no existence of musical performances until 2005, gained popularity eventually in the following years.

Task Achievement / Task Response — Band 6.0
You have successfully identified the main trends and provided a clear overview. You covered all five activities and made relevant comparisons, such as noting the film club's dominance and the contrasting trends of table tennis and amateur dramatics. However, the report lacks specific data points to support your observations. For instance, you mention a 'sharp rise' for table tennis but do not provide the starting or ending figures. To reach a higher band, ensure you include key data points (e.g., specific years or participant numbers) to illustrate your descriptions more precisely, rather than relying solely on general trends.
Coherence and Cohesion — Band 6.0
The response is logically organized with a clear introduction, overview, and body paragraphs. You use some cohesive devices effectively, such as 'On the contrary' and 'Lastly'. However, the progression of ideas is occasionally slightly mechanical. For example, the transition between the overview and the body paragraphs could be smoother. Additionally, some referencing is slightly repetitive, such as the repeated use of 'number of participants'. Improving the variety of cohesive links and ensuring that each paragraph focuses on a distinct group of trends would enhance the flow and coherence of your writing.
Lexical Resource — Band 5.5
You demonstrate an adequate range of vocabulary for the task, using terms like 'participated', 'steady fall', and 'gained popularity'. There are some minor inaccuracies in word choice and phrasing, such as 'no existence of musical performances' (which is slightly unnatural) and 'in case of film club'. To improve, try to use more precise collocations and avoid repeating the same phrases. Incorporating more varied vocabulary to describe trends, such as 'fluctuated' instead of 'ups and downs', would help demonstrate a more sophisticated lexical range.
Grammatical Range and Accuracy — Band 5.5
You use a mix of simple and complex sentence structures, which is appropriate for this task. There are some grammatical errors, such as 'in 5 different activities' (should be 'in five different activities'), 'Australian' (should be 'Australia'), and 'grew afterwards on the later years' (should be 'in later years'). While these errors do not impede communication, they occur frequently enough to prevent a higher score. Focus on subject-verb agreement and preposition usage to increase the accuracy of your writing. Most of your sentences are clear, but refining these small errors will improve your overall control.
